Claux Amic Golf Course, Grasse

17th century hunting estate offering a technical 18-hole golf course

This golf course is located on a charming old private hunting estate dating back to the 17th century.

The walled site has fairways through oak, pine and broom forests and offers superb views over the bay of Cannes, the Lerins Islands and the Esterel Massif.

This 18-hole is hilly and quite technical. Players will have to share tactics and use precision rather than just have driving power. The club has an area for training with a driving range and two putting greens.

The clubhouse has a pro shop, restaurant, bar and locker room. You can hire the services of a caddy or teaching pro, if you wish.

The neighbourhood

The golf course is just a 15 minute drive from the charming town of Grasse, famous for its perfumeries. The surrounding countryside is very beautiful and offers lots of possibilities for hiking, bike riding and other activities. There are a number of food and wine tours that you can do in the area.

The Restaurant

Open daily from 8am to 7pm, the restaurant serves traditional dishes made from fresh local produce. You can dine à la carte, or choose the daily two-course lunch menu for around 15€. The restaurant has a sunny terrace with views of the forest and golf course.

Directions

The golf course is just 8km north-west of Grasse, and 25km from the Riviera town of Cannes.
